In March 2019, Sony announced that Driveclub , along with its VR and Bikes versions, would be removed from the PlayStation Store. The game's servers were permanently shut down on March 31, 2020. This means you can no longer buy a digital copy, and many of its online features, like clubs and multiplayer, are gone forever. Few racing games have had a legacy as turbulent yet beloved as Driveclub . Developed by Evolution Studios and published by Sony Computer Entertainment, Driveclub was originally envisioned as a PlayStation 4 flagship racing exclusive—a social-driven, cloud-connected racer meant to showcase the console’s graphical prowess.
